Transaction 43ef583ad21288dcf14bb006fe83748c40d3456f2fff018f23e1e7de77480bf5

50 Input
2 Outputs
  • 43ef583ad21288dcf14bb006fe83748c40d3456f2fff018f23e1e7de77480bf5:0
  • value  11523464
    address  3MtmjEp4pvRvKebfMcswYCBKMtrEDkF3sC
  • 43ef583ad21288dcf14bb006fe83748c40d3456f2fff018f23e1e7de77480bf5:1
  • value  296240
    address  3HL1QmiZaAT85uRXuNGq2y7rYR4thhBubc